EASY invests in US large-cap companies with long records of paying and raising dividends, emphasizing businesses the Adviser defines as recession resistant. These are firms with steady demand for their products or services even during downturns, supported by low demand elasticity, recurring revenues, and high switching costs. They also typically show lower earnings volatility, more stable cash flows and less sensitivity to business cycles. EASYs approach combines top-down sector analysis with company-level screening to identify candidates with sustainable dividend policies and moderate to low revenue variability. The portfolio tends to tilt toward sectors such as consumer staples, utilities, pharmaceuticals, and technology but retains flexibility to adjust exposures as market conditions evolve. By focusing on companies with a demonstrated ability to maintain dividend growth through economic cycles, the fund seeks to balance capital appreciation with reliable income.

The company leases its properties to middle-market companies, such as restaurants, car washes, automotive services, medical and dental services, convenience stores, equipment rental, entertainment, early childhood education, grocery, and health and fitness on a long-term basis. As of December 31, 2021, it had a portfolio of 1, 451 properties. The company qualifies as a real estate investment trust for federal income tax purposes. It generally would not be subject to federal corporate income taxes if it distributes at least 90% of its taxable income to its stockholders. The company was founded in 2016 and is headquartered in Princeton, New Jersey.
